二次开发

BI应用

耗尽温柔 提交于 2020-03-23 17:25:50
随着信息技术应用的普及,中小企业通过计算机软件实现了财务、销售、人力等管理,逐渐积累了一定的管理信息数据。如何综合利用这些数据资源,充分发挥企业的竞争优势呢?同时,中小企业需要和客户、供货商、多家政府管理部门等进行一定的信息交换和交流,如何灵活而小代价地实现这些需求呢? 其实这就是BI(商业智能)应用的 范畴 ,现对自己工作中应用到的产品作个简单的说明. HappyBI (快乐商业智能) 就是为国内中小企业打造的商业智能解决方案, 其是完全免费且易学易用,功能实用. HappyBI 产品包括: ※ HappyReport 画布式国产报表工具。在 C/S 和 B/S 环境下,支持复杂报表的设计、预览和打印,并且是优秀的二次开发工具。适合中小企业对关键业务信息的组织和展示。 ※ HappyETL 最具有扩展能力的国产 ETL 工具。支持数据抽取、转换和加载,实时监控任务执行情况,支持计划和调度。适合中小企业对各类数据资源的收集、转换和整理。 ※ HappyPortal 通过 WEB 访问报表,提供精确的打印输出。适合中小企业实现集中式 WEB 查询。    ※ HappyPrint 灵活的票据套打工具,支持定义复杂的票据格式,操作简单直观。适合中小企业实现票据打印。 HappyBI 的特色: ※真正免费    HappyBI 免费使用,可从 HappyBI 实践网 下载

EasyNVR、EasyDSS二次开发之:RTMP、HLS流在web页面进行无插件播放示例Demo代码

淺唱寂寞╮ 提交于 2020-03-22 04:42:03
不管是基于EasyNVR还是EasyDSS,都是支持无插件直播,这也是未来视频直播的一个趋势。对于传统的浏览器插件播放谁用谁知道; 以上是软件自带播放展示 背景需求 对于EasyNVR和EasyDSS的使用方式大概分为两大类,一类是直接将软件作为视频能力平台来进行使用;另一类就是将视频能力集成到自身的业务系统来,这就涉及到相关的接口调用和一些对应的功能的集成。对与前端的web播放器的集成也是一个 需要注意的方向;通常也有很多客户会咨询到关于web播放器集成的相关问题,本篇博客也是对应web流媒体播放器的demo介绍。 解决方案 对于流媒体的web播放器有很多,不管的ckplay、flowplayer、腾讯、阿里等;我们的Easy系列软件使用的是Videojs,因此本篇主要介绍的也是Videojs如何实现HLS、RTMP流的web播放; 引用相关文件 <link rel="stylesheet" href="plugins/video-js-5.19.2/video-js.css"/> <script src="plugins/video-js-5.19.2/video.js"></script> <script src="plugins/video-js-5.19.2/videojs-contrib-hls4.js"></script> <script src="plugins

易扩展二次开发的web快速开发平台

前提是你 提交于 2020-03-19 16:46:46
我们先来看看web快速开发平台的发展 从编程之初,便免不了和方法,类,接口之类的东西打交道。久而久之,自然会对此进行总结,由此而产生了开发平台。而今中国的程序员之中,有很大一部分都是编一些企业MIS、政府MIS之类的程序。其主要工作就是对数据进行一下增删改查的操作,对MIS系统做一些基础的管理而已。随着互联网的流行,自然又要求以互联网为基础,把这些都网络化,以实现网络资源共享,而不是传统的单机模式。诸如用友、金蝶等都有自己的开发构件库,还有SAP的ABAP开发平台等等。但是ABAP开发平台太复杂,一般的程序员一下子很难用起来;而用友金蝶的开发构件库又只能自己用,无法开放出来,所以难于通用。所以说早起的开发平台的基本状况是:要么功能强大,使用复杂;要么难于通用。随着IE的出现,这种类型的开发平台也就被迫要转向web开发平台了。 web快速开发平台的性质 web开发平台究竟是属于技术平台还是业务平台呢?一般来说,技术平台是指技术人员使用的平台,业务平台是指业务人员使用的平台。那如果web开发平台易学易用,则可以归结为业务平台。而如果web开发平台功能强大并有要求技术含量高,则可以归结为技术平台。显然,web开发平台在业务平台跟技术平台两者之间徘徊。怎么样能让web开发平台既功能强大,又简单易学易用,是每个web开发平台的设计者所必须面临的问题。而在这个问题的处理上

Scratch3 二次开发系列

▼魔方 西西 提交于 2020-02-18 07:12:24
Scratch3.0来啦!!! Scratch做为图像化编程的首选语言,拖过积木块搭建实现动画游戏的制作。Scratch3添加了音乐、画笔、视频侦测、文字朗读、翻译等选择性下载扩展积木,可实现积木块转代码(C、Javascript、python等),可实现和硬件的交互(互动模式、烧录模式)。 在接下来有时间会持续对二次开发系列专题进行详细讲解(都是干货!) Scratch3的二次开发系列 1. Scratch3架构结构说明   2. Scratch3自定义积木块之新增积木块 3. Scratch3自定义积木块之积木块与角色、舞台的交互 4. Scratch3添加拓展之新增拓展 5. Scratch3添加拓展之新增硬件交互拓展 6. Scratch3代码转换之Javascript 7. Scratch3代码转换之Python 8. Scratch3硬件交互之通信工具 9. Scratch3硬件交互之代码转换 10. Scratch3硬件交互之代码烧录 11. Scratch3界面定制之GUI开发 Scratch3仍处于官方修复阶段,二次开发甚至官方说明比较少,对于二次开发的先行者在使用和开发的过程中会遇到种种问题! 欢迎志同道合者多多沟通、相互交流! QQ群:452783077 - Scratch3.0二次开发交流群 个人QQ:438759715 来源: https://www

一品资源网自用官网模板源码下载站(带手机模板)

China☆狼群 提交于 2020-02-12 13:03:35
★模板介绍★ 一品 资源网 自用官网模板源码下载站(带手机模板)本套源码为dedecms二次开发而来,也是本站 一品 资源网 自用的原版本打包,提供本套作 品 的初衷是为了能上更多想做下载站的站长朋友拥有一套更容易操作的系统,本套源码包含多个专业的下载站功能,页面代码设计整洁,方便用户二次开发,大致功能可以参考以下列举的功能说明! ★ 二次开发如下功能说明和介绍★ 1.缩略图懒加载(提升访问速度) 2.后台幻灯片控制(方便快速修改幻灯片) 3.QQ登录插件(方便用户快速注册) 4.列表页支持二级导航筛选,支持内容排序筛选(独创功能) 5.新的作 品 发布加上New样式 6.内容页效果多图+小图自动剪切(小图自动剪切展示在内容页主要是提升内容页打开速度) 7.多原化下载模式(1.VIP免费下载功能,2.VIP原创打折功能,3.VIP下载次数限制功能) 8.下载记录(详细记录每个会员的下载次数) 9.模板售出邮件提示(设计师在平台发布作 品 被购买后会员邮件通知设计师) 10.作 品 发布(支持设计师发布作 品 并设置分成) 11.收益记录(设计师发布的作 品 可以查看到具体销售记录) 12.会员提现(支持会员申请提现) 13.实名认证(实名认证后可以使用提现功能) 14.自定义充值(自定义设置充值金币多少) 来源: https://www.cnblogs.com/qq5984000

十款(asp)cms源码

眉间皱痕 提交于 2020-02-04 16:37:25
第一名:动易 http://www.powereasy.net/ 动易无疑是ASPCMS系统中的老大哥了,国内著名的站长综合网站“网页吧”采用的也是这套系统,这套国产AspCMS是一套非常强大的且人性话系统,一路走来,动易不断完善,而且也不断加强功能,包括个人版,学校版,政府版,企业版,后台包括的功能,信息发布,类别管理,权限控制,信息采集,而且跟第三方的程序,比如论坛,商城, blog可以完美结合,基本上可以满足一个中大型网站的要求,但Asp和Access的的局限性,还有本身功能Dll的限制,使得免费版差不多成鸡肋。这套系统比较适合非专业人士使用,在使用操作方面做的非常人性话,而如果说想自己修改或者二次开发的话就有点免为其难了。 人气指数:★★★★★ 人性化指数:★★★★★ 适宜二次开发指数:★★ 适宜人群:不需要对网站程序修改者,适宜网站类型:各类网站 第二名:乔客 http://www.joekoe.com/ 乔客从最早的整站系统,到V系列,再到CMS1.0/1.2/2.0/3.0,一路走来经历不少波折,从早期的大红大紫到被动易的迎头赶上如今似乎一直处于压抑状态,3.0的使用者了了无几,远不如1.2受欢迎,但饿死的骆驼比马大,这位ASPCMS界中元老级别的系统在不断的探索着CMS新的出路,其系统最大的特点是整合了各类的程序模块,有自带论坛,博客圈,影视频道,音乐频道,下载频道

.NET AutoCAD二次开发之路(一、基础篇)

烈酒焚心 提交于 2020-01-23 07:43:15
学习AutoCAD二次开发已经有一段时间了,磕磕碰碰,十分的艰辛枯燥。但回想一下还是会有些小激动,嘿嘿!最近这段时间一直都有这么个想法,就是将我学习CAD二次开发的过程用文字的方式记录下来,形成系列,并定期更新。主要内容就是记录自己每天学习过程中所碰见的问题和感悟,并总结今天所学到的内容。目的一是激励自己坚持下去,看着自己一步一步的提高,多有成就感。还有就是和大家积极沟通,希望能够指正我的错误,减少我的弯路。再者就是望能给后面学习的人一点点借鉴经验,好吧其实还有点装B的心里。废话不多说就进入今天的正题: ⦁ 使用工具:Visual Studio 2013和AutoCAD2010 ⦁ 学习工具:《AutoCAD VBA和VB.NET开发基础和实例教程》C#版、《深入浅出AutoCAD.NET二次开发》、《AutoCAD .net开发人员手册》和网络(目前) ⦁ 操作系统:Win10 64位 ⦁ 开发语言:C# ⦁ 软件设置: 1.打开Visual Studio 2013,新建一个【类库】项目; 2.在软件右侧【解决方案资源管理器】(如果没有,在【视图】中选择第一个选项即可)的项目内找到“引用”,右击选择【添加引用】,然后选择【浏览】选项卡,接着找到CAD安装目录下的acdbmgd.dll和acmgd.dll这两个文件,【确定】; 3.在“引用”中找到刚引用的两个文件acdbmgd

海康摄像头二次开发详解,包含海康摄像头登录、海康云台控制、视频下载等功能

怎甘沉沦 提交于 2020-01-21 02:45:45
海康摄像头二次开发详解 准备 海康摄像头SDK开发下载路径: 开发过程中遇到的问题记录: 添加maven依赖 下面代码中会出现的实体类 CameraManage实体类: ControlDto实体类: 加载库文件: 初始化: 登录 控制: 查询历史视频保存时间: 退出登陆释放资源: 完整代码: 视频下载、回放、视频直播、抓图等功能 准备 海康摄像头SDK开发下载路径: https://www.hikvision.com/cn/download_61.html 下载解压之后的目录结构: 1 中为需要加载的库文件;2中有所需的jar包及HCNetSDK.java文件 开发过程中遇到的问题记录: 一定要记得开启日志打印与及时获取最后一次的错误状态码 一个ip下面会有多个摄像头 如果返回的错误状态码为10:有可能是端口不对,改用8000试试 如果可以登陆却无法控制,有可能是通道错误,有的摄像机通道从1开始,有的从33开始【可通过NET_DVR_GetDVRConfig/NET_DVR_SetDVRConfig来查询和修改相关配置】 查询保存的历史视频的起始时间时:NET_DVR_RECORD_TIME_SPAN_INQUIRY结构体占用内存的大小是68个字节 添加maven依赖 < ! -- 海康录像机二次开发依赖jar包 -- > < dependency > < groupId >